The objective of this online induction program is to provide each employee of Porgera Joint Venture all the necessary information to remain safe and healthy and for each person to understand the company safety and environment policies and procedures.

Every employee of the Porgera Joint Venture must participate in the online induction program and pass each topic to the satisfaction of the Company.

Further site induction modules will follow the completion of the online program and all employees must complete both elements before the commencement of their role.

Our Story

The Porgera Gold Mine is located in the Enga Province of Papua New Guinea at an altitude of 2,200 – 2,700 meters. It is 130 kilometers west of Mt Hagen and 600 kilometers northwest of the capital Port Moresby.
 
The Porgera Joint Venture (PJV) owns the Porgera Mine which is operated by Barrick (Niugini) Limited ("BNL") on behalf of the JV partners.
 
 The Porgera Gold Mine has produced more than 20 million ounces of gold and contributed approximately 10% of Papua New Guinea’s total annual exports over the life of the mine to date.

The re-opening of the site planned for 2022 launched a new online induction program to be developed to ensure all employees are brought up to date with any changes, and to ensure all employees are aware of relevant safety and environmental policies and procedures.
